Satoshi Era Bitcoin Miner Moves Funds After 14-Year Dormancy

A dormant miner wallet from the "Satoshi era" reactivates after 14 years, transferring $3 million worth of bitcoin.

A Bitcoin miner from the Bitcoin’s early days, known as the “Satoshi era,” has emerged from dormancy after nearly 14 years. This miner, whose identity remains shrouded in mystery, recently made waves by transferring 50 bitcoin (BTC) worth over $3 million to various wallets, including the renowned exchange Coinbase.

Long Dormant Funds On The Move

The miner in question earned the 50 BTC in April 2010, during the nascent stages of Bitcoin’s existence. Since then, these holdings remained untouched, symbolizing a relic from Bitcoin’s early days. The sudden movement of these assets after such a prolonged period of dormancy has sparked intrigue and speculation among enthusiasts and analysts alike.

Since it’s coinbase transaction in 2010, the address has only had one other input of 547 sats, commonly referred to as “dust.” However, on April 15, 2024, an outgoing transaction was observed for the address. It involved moving 17 BTC ($1.1 million) to one address and 33 BTC ($2.1 million) to another. The 17 BTC went to a wallet known for transferring funds to exchanges. It was then combined with funds labeled as Coinbase on the Arkham blockchain analytics platform and sent to another address, possibly indicating a transfer to an exchange.

The transfer of these long-dormant bitcoin holdings is not an isolated incident. Similar occurrences have been observed in recent years and months, indicating a trend of wallets from the “Satoshi era” coming to life. In July 2023, a dormant wallet stirred after 11 years, moving a staggering $30 million worth of bitcoin to other wallets. Subsequent movements in August and December of the same year further highlighted the resurfacing of early bitcoin assets.

Notably, there were other similar transfers in the recent days. On April 6, 2024, a whale holding 1,701 BTC sprung back to life after 10 years of silence. This event rocked the market shortly after another huge sum was moved by another entity on March 5, transferring 1,000 BTC which had been left untouched for 10 years.

Analyst Insights

According to on-chain analysts, Lookonchain, the recent transfer of 50 BTC to Coinbase represents a significant event within the bitcoin space. Such movements from wallets associated with Bitcoin’s early days underscore the evolving landscape of digital assets and the potential impact on market dynamics.

The resurfacing of bitcoin from the Satoshi era highlights the evolving nature of the market and shifts in users’ sentiments. It’s indicative of renewed interest and activity among early adopters, potentially shaping the trajectory of Bitcoin’s journey.

The sudden awakening of these long-dormant wallets has led to various speculations within the community. Some speculate that these movements could be strategic financial decisions, aiming to capitalize on bitcoin’s current market surge. Others theorize that lost private keys might have been rediscovered, prompting the transfer of assets.

Impact on Market Dynamics

The transfer of such a substantial amount of bitcoin, particularly in the midst of a market surge, is expected to have repercussions on market dynamics. Increased activity from early miners and holders could potentially lead to heightened volatility in the short term, as observed in previous instances.
